Wis 2:1a,12-22; Ps 33:17-21,23 and Jn 7:1-2,10,25-30.


The sins of envy and jealousy are twin brothers/sisters, and are like two sides of the same coin. They are also like very tiny or the smallest seeds and when they are allowed to germinate, they grow into a huge or mighty tree known as ‘acute hatred’. This is one of the deadly sins in the world. The earlier we avoid or eradicate these sins in our lives the better.


Envious people, leading to resentful and hateful feelings are crooked, evil and sinful. Such people are never balanced or correct. They always have distorted reasoning and they wrongly judge issues. Envy and jealousy often lead to the denial of one’s true self or being, and eventually, they result in other disastrous things in life.


The scripture passages we are reflecting on today shed more light on the above. The portion of the Book of Wisdom (2:1a,12-22) describes the misguided reasoning of those who condemned the prophet(s) all because the prophet pointed out their wrong and sinful ways to them. The prophets tried to let them know themselves and then avoid their evil ways and come back to God and be saved.


However, because the people had misguided reasoning that also affected their sense of judgment, they hated the prophets and therefore they were planning to eliminate or kill him: “Let us condemn him to a shameful death” because “he is obnoxious to us”. This same fate awaited Jesus (Cf. Jn 7:1-2,10,25-30). The religious leaders of the Jews were envious and jealous of Jesus and this eventually developed into an acute hatred for Jesus. They also, like the accusers of the prophets had misguided reasoning and a wrong sense of judgment. Also because of pride and arrogance they were not ready to accept corrections from Jesus to come to terms with themselves and therefore be saved.


It is true even in our generation that at times when someone wrongly acts out of envy, jealousy and hatred and you want to correct the person, he/she sometimes thinks that you are accusing him/her or that you are against him/her. This is one major cause of the disharmony and violence in our world. One manifestation of envy, jealousy and acute hatred is non-cooperation with people. If you are one, please avoid it.
